Mary Cody's offers a mixed dining experience that sparks a range of opinions from patrons. While some appreciate the cozy atmosphere, friendly staff, and homemade breakfast options, others have encountered challenges such as long wait times, inconsistent service, and overcooked meals. The decor has been described as drab, with a disjointed menu failing to impress. However, instances of exceptional service, particularly during busy events like Mother's Day, highlight the staff's commitment to guest satisfaction. Overall, Mary Cody's embodies a charm that may appeal to some, but leaves others yearning for a more consistent and elevated dining experience.

Well, found an unexpected gem in Onalaska. This place is small, quiet, almost romantic.. We started with the blue chips... yum! House made potato chips, covered in crumbled bleu cheese and drizzled with a balsamic glaze... nachos style.. damn. Very creatice. Delicious! I opted for the Jam Burger.. a burger, cooked exactly how I ordered it, medium rare, with caramelized onions, fig jam and gouda cheese... Wow!!! It was as delicious and unusual as it sounds. What a great combo.
